ABSTRACT:
A method and apparatus for power-based radio resource management in wireless radio systems based on continuously measuring a total interference power/totand own-cell interference power/ownas well as a continuously estimating the system noise power PNand/or the other-to-own cell interference ratio i based on these measurements. As a result, improved values PNand i are provided and a more accurate load factor
oise rise calculation can be performed.
